Selo’s Industrial Soup Production Line offers a robust solution for food manufacturers and producers seeking consistency and versatility in their soup operations. This fully automated system integrates ingredient handling, cooking, and precise filling, adeptly managing both solid and liquid components. Capable of producing a wide range of soups—from fresh gazpacho to pasteurized creamy soups—it’s equipped to handle raw ingredients through to final packaging seamlessly.

The line utilizes direct steam injection and vacuum cooking for efficient pasteurization, ensuring longer shelf life and enhanced flavor without compromising on quality. Operating with a continuous processing capability, it meets the demands of high-volume production lines, tailoring to needs of up to thousands of liters per hour. Its PLC-controlled operations allow for integration with upstream and downstream processes, minimizing downtime and maximizing throughput.

Energy efficiency is a focal point, with advanced motor controls reducing consumption by approximately 30%, translating into lower operational costs. Fabricated with high-grade stainless steel, it ensures durability and meets EHEDG hygiene standards, critical for maintaining food safety and compliance.

Maintenance is streamlined via an integrated CIP (Clean-In-Place) system, reducing contamination risk and maintenance downtime.
